Ordinals
beta
Sat 759334850199759
decimal
151866.4850199759
degree
0°151866′666″4850199759‴
percentile
36.15880243023941%
name
ilwykbfhena
cycle
0
epoch
0
period
75
block
151866
offset
4850199759
timestamp
2011-11-04 20:33:27 UTC
rarity
common
prev
next